| @@ -1,14 +1,14 @@ | | | @@ -1,14 +1,14 @@ |
1 | # $NetBSD: mozilla-common.mk,v 1.147 2019/12/04 05:13:56 gutteridge Exp $ | | 1 | # $NetBSD: mozilla-common.mk,v 1.148 2020/01/10 07:21:08 gutteridge Exp $ |
2 | # | | 2 | # |
3 | # common Makefile fragment for mozilla packages based on gecko 2.0. | | 3 | # common Makefile fragment for mozilla packages based on gecko 2.0. |
4 | # | | 4 | # |
5 | # used by www/firefox/Makefile | | 5 | # used by www/firefox/Makefile |
6 | | | 6 | |
7 | .include "../../mk/bsd.prefs.mk" | | 7 | .include "../../mk/bsd.prefs.mk" |
8 | | | 8 | |
9 | # Python 2.7 and Python 3.6 or later are required simultaneously. | | 9 | # Python 2.7 and Python 3.6 or later are required simultaneously. |
10 | PYTHON_VERSIONS_ACCEPTED= 27 | | 10 | PYTHON_VERSIONS_ACCEPTED= 27 |
11 | PYTHON_FOR_BUILD_ONLY= tool | | 11 | PYTHON_FOR_BUILD_ONLY= tool |
12 | .if !empty(PYTHON_VERSION_DEFAULT:M3[6789]) | | 12 | .if !empty(PYTHON_VERSION_DEFAULT:M3[6789]) |
13 | TOOL_DEPENDS+= python${PYTHON_VERSION_DEFAULT}-[0-9]*:../../lang/python${PYTHON_VERSION_DEFAULT} | | 13 | TOOL_DEPENDS+= python${PYTHON_VERSION_DEFAULT}-[0-9]*:../../lang/python${PYTHON_VERSION_DEFAULT} |
14 | ALL_ENV+= PYTHON3=${LOCALBASE}/bin/python${PYTHON_VERSION_DEFAULT:S/3/3./} | | 14 | ALL_ENV+= PYTHON3=${LOCALBASE}/bin/python${PYTHON_VERSION_DEFAULT:S/3/3./} |
| @@ -199,30 +199,30 @@ PREFER.bzip2?= pkgsrc | | | @@ -199,30 +199,30 @@ PREFER.bzip2?= pkgsrc |
199 | | | 199 | |
200 | .if ${OPSYS} == "OpenBSD" | | 200 | .if ${OPSYS} == "OpenBSD" |
201 | PLIST_SUBST+= DLL_SUFFIX=".so.1.0" | | 201 | PLIST_SUBST+= DLL_SUFFIX=".so.1.0" |
202 | .elif ${OPSYS} == "Darwin" | | 202 | .elif ${OPSYS} == "Darwin" |
203 | PLIST_SUBST+= DLL_SUFFIX=".dylib" | | 203 | PLIST_SUBST+= DLL_SUFFIX=".dylib" |
204 | .else | | 204 | .else |
205 | PLIST_SUBST+= DLL_SUFFIX=".so" | | 205 | PLIST_SUBST+= DLL_SUFFIX=".so" |
206 | .endif | | 206 | .endif |
207 | | | 207 | |
208 | .include "../../archivers/bzip2/buildlink3.mk" | | 208 | .include "../../archivers/bzip2/buildlink3.mk" |
209 | BUILDLINK_API_DEPENDS.libevent+= libevent>=1.1 | | 209 | BUILDLINK_API_DEPENDS.libevent+= libevent>=1.1 |
210 | .include "../../devel/libevent/buildlink3.mk" | | 210 | .include "../../devel/libevent/buildlink3.mk" |
211 | .include "../../devel/libffi/buildlink3.mk" | | 211 | .include "../../devel/libffi/buildlink3.mk" |
212 | BUILDLINK_API_DEPENDS.nspr+= nspr>=4.23 | | 212 | BUILDLINK_API_DEPENDS.nspr+= nspr>=4.24 |
213 | .include "../../devel/nspr/buildlink3.mk" | | 213 | .include "../../devel/nspr/buildlink3.mk" |
214 | .include "../../textproc/icu/buildlink3.mk" | | 214 | .include "../../textproc/icu/buildlink3.mk" |
215 | BUILDLINK_API_DEPENDS.nss+= nss>=3.47.1 | | 215 | BUILDLINK_API_DEPENDS.nss+= nss>=3.48 |
216 | .include "../../devel/nss/buildlink3.mk" | | 216 | .include "../../devel/nss/buildlink3.mk" |
217 | .include "../../devel/zlib/buildlink3.mk" | | 217 | .include "../../devel/zlib/buildlink3.mk" |
218 | #.include "../../mk/jpeg.buildlink3.mk" | | 218 | #.include "../../mk/jpeg.buildlink3.mk" |
219 | .include "../../graphics/MesaLib/buildlink3.mk" | | 219 | .include "../../graphics/MesaLib/buildlink3.mk" |
220 | #BUILDLINK_API_DEPENDS.cairo+= cairo>=1.10.2nb4 | | 220 | #BUILDLINK_API_DEPENDS.cairo+= cairo>=1.10.2nb4 |
221 | #.include "../../graphics/cairo/buildlink3.mk" | | 221 | #.include "../../graphics/cairo/buildlink3.mk" |
222 | BUILDLINK_API_DEPENDS.libwebp+= libwebp>=1.0.2 | | 222 | BUILDLINK_API_DEPENDS.libwebp+= libwebp>=1.0.2 |
223 | .include "../../graphics/libwebp/buildlink3.mk" | | 223 | .include "../../graphics/libwebp/buildlink3.mk" |
224 | PKG_CC= ${PREFIX}/bin/clang | | 224 | PKG_CC= ${PREFIX}/bin/clang |
225 | PKG_CXX= ${PREFIX}/bin/clang++ | | 225 | PKG_CXX= ${PREFIX}/bin/clang++ |
226 | BUILDLINK_DEPMETHOD.clang= build | | 226 | BUILDLINK_DEPMETHOD.clang= build |
227 | BUILDLINK_API_DEPENDS.clang+= clang>=6.0.1nb1 | | 227 | BUILDLINK_API_DEPENDS.clang+= clang>=6.0.1nb1 |
228 | .include "../../lang/clang/buildlink3.mk" | | 228 | .include "../../lang/clang/buildlink3.mk" |